Military training often involves group exercises and close quarters living. During these periods, members learn how to work together as a team, which may involve intense physical activity. These activities foster strong bonds between soldiers, creating an environment where sexual tension can arise.

Military culture frowns upon open expression of sexual desire among its members. As a result, many soldiers struggle with feelings of guilt, shame, and confusion regarding their sexuality. Some turn to alcohol, drugs, or other forms of escapism to cope with these emotions. Others seek out anonymous sexual encounters to satisfy their desires.

The military also emphasizes conformity and obedience, which can be detrimental to sexual exploration. Members who challenge traditional gender roles are often ostracized or punished.

Men who explore feminine interests or women who embrace masculinity may face harassment or abuse from their peers. This pressure to fit into rigid gender norms can lead to self-doubt, anxiety, and depression.

In addition to sexuality, military discipline impacts intimacy and relationships. Soldiers spend extended periods away from home, which can make it difficult for them to maintain healthy romantic relationships. Military couples often face unique challenges, such as frequent moves, long deployments, and constant separation. They must adapt to changing circumstances quickly and stay connected through letters, emails, and phone calls. These factors can strain even the strongest relationships.
